Types of Ovens Available
When browsing for an oven in the UK, purchasers will encounter a number of types, each customized to various cooking needs and kitchen layouts. Below is a breakdown of the most typical types:
1. Standard Ovens
These ovens run using traditional heating elements. They are straightforward, frequently seen in many homes, and are normally readily available in both gas and electric designs.
2. Fan Ovens (Convection Ovens)
Fan ovens and hob circulate hot air around the food, providing even heat distribution. This leads to quicker cooking times and is specifically advantageous for baking.
3. Multifunction Ovens
Multifunction ovens supply a mix of cooking methods, including grilling, baking, and steaming. They offer flexibility and are perfect for cooks who desire more alternatives.
4. Steam Ovens
Ideal for health-conscious cooks, steam ovens protect nutrients and tastes in food through using steam. They are frequently discovered in modern cooking areas looking for to maximize healthy cooking choices.
5. Variety Cookers
Range cookers integrate numerous cooking approaches in one home appliance. Usually bigger, these models include a number of burners on leading and an oven or several ovens below, accommodating large families or passionate cooks.
6. Wall Ovens
Wall ovens are built in ovens sale into the wall of a kitchen and are developed to save area while offering ergonomic access to cooking. They are typically eye-level, making it much easier to monitor food while cooking.
7. Double Ovens
Double ovens consist of two separate oven compartments, allowing for simultaneous cooking at different temperature levels. This function is especially helpful for hosting gatherings or during festive seasons.
Factors to Consider Before Buying an Oven
When preparing to buy an oven in the UK, numerous essential aspects need to influence the decision-making process:
Size and Space: Evaluate the readily available space in the kitchen. Measure the location where the oven will be installed to make sure an ideal fit.
Kind of Fuel: Determine whether you choose gas or electric. Gas ovens provide instant heat and control, while electric ovens supply consistent heating and are generally much easier to clean up.
Energy Efficiency: Look for ovens uk with high energy scores. Energy-efficient models not only help decrease costs but are likewise much better for the environment.
Budget plan: Set a spending plan before shopping. Ovens are available in various cost varieties, and comprehending what features are needed versus high-end choices can guarantee a more satisfactory purchase.
Brand name Reputation: Research brands and read reviews. Established brands often supply warranties and have a reputation for quality service.
Functions: Consider the additional functions readily available such as self-cleaning options, smart innovation, programmable settings, and security features if cooking around children.

1. What is the standard size of ovens in the UK?
The basic size for built-in ovens is typically 60cm broad, however there are variations available. Variety cookers can be broader, often going beyond 90cm.
2. Are gas ovens better than electric ovens?
It depends upon personal preference. Gas ovens offer quick temperature level control, while electric ovens provide even heat. Each type has its own benefits.
3. How can I make sure energy effectiveness when using an hob oven?
Use the hob oven for complete loads, preheat when essential, and avoid unlocking frequently to inspect on food.
